Maintenance Control Centre (MCC) Engineer – A320 Family | Central Europe | Permanent

Hub Selection is recruiting on behalf of a leading aviation organisation for an experienced Maintenance Control Centre (MCC) Engineer to join their technical operations team in Central Europe.

This is an excellent opportunity for an aircraft maintenance professional with strong technical knowledge and experience in a Part-145 or Part-M environment who is looking to move into a dynamic MCC role.

Key Responsibilities
  • Monitor and coordinate the technical status of the fleet to ensure maximum aircraft availability.
  • Provide technical support to line maintenance stations and maintenance providers.
  • Coordinate defect rectification and deferred defect management in accordance with regulatory requ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with EASA Part-145, Part-M and company procedures.
  • Liaise with Engineering, Planning, CAMO and Maintenance Providers to resolve technical issues efficiently.
  • Maintain accurate technical records and documentation within the company's maintenance systems.
  • Support AOG events and operational recovery activities when required.
Requirements
Experience
  • Minimum 3–5 years of relevant aviation maintenance experience.
  • At least 2 years' experience within an EASA Part-145 or Part-M approved organisation.
  • Previous MCC, Technical Control, CAMO or Line Maintenance experience is advantageous.
Technical Knowledge
  • Thorough knowledge of EASA Part-145 and Part-M regulations, including Subpart I.
  • Strong understanding of CAME and MOE.
  • Good working knowledge of AMOS.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office.
Qualifications
  • Aircraft Technical Education.
  • EASA Part-66 Category B1.1 Licence.
  • A320 CEO/NEO Family Type Training (Level III) is desirable.
  • A330 training would be considered an advantage.
  • Current Fuel Tank Safety (FTS), EWIS, and Human Factors training.
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Engineering or Business Administration is advantageous.
